The latest rumors about the MacBook Pro 2016 seem to focus on whether it will come with a Touch Screen feature. While other analysts believe that Apple will finally proceed in this direction, Apple allegedly squashed these rumors. 

According to Yibada, Apple rejected the idea of including touch screen on Macbook Pro 2016. The tech giant allegedly believes that their touchpad is powerful enough to provide all the touch capabilities desired and needed by their users.

Gotta Be Mobile also claimed that the Macbook Pro 2016 will have the Force Touch Trackpad, making a touch screen feature unnecessary. "The Force Touch trackpad lets you tap to bring up a menu or hover over an item, while a hard press would select an item. Essentially, the trackpad doubles its capabilities this way, and it gets this technology from the Apple Watch, which was the first Apple product to incorporate Force Touch," the site predicts.
